Unified Business OS: Salesforce Transformation
Architected a centralized Salesforce org consolidating five siloed tools, automating client lifecycle, and delivering real‑time financials – resulting in 100% data accuracy, doubled sales, and scalable operations.
Overview
Spearheaded the complete architecture and implementation of a centralized business operating system by building a comprehensive Salesforce org from the ground up. This project consolidated disparate, siloed tools—Pipedrive, Chargeover, Stripe—into a single source of truth to drive sales, legal, and financial operations.
The Problem
- Five disconnected systems created data silos and manual reconciliation
- No unified view of client lifecycle from lead to active case
- Financial data discrepancies between sales, billing, and accounting
- Sales forecasting was impossible without reliable data
- Customer service teams lacked visibility into client status
- Manual handoffs between departments caused delays and errors
As project manager, Juni coordinated with the client’s Salesforce developers to design and deliver a solution that would eliminate these bottlenecks.
The Solution
Intake & Qualification
Pre‑screening forms and web‑to‑lead via Typeform feed directly into Salesforce, triggering internal qualification workflows.
Sales Automation
Qualified leads automatically schedule meetings via Calendly API; all activity tracked in Salesforce.
Legal Automation
PandaDoc generates dynamic representation agreements, sends for signature, and tracks status directly within Salesforce.
Financial Engine
Integration with Kulturra and Cardpointe automates billing—payment links, invoices, collections, and statements—all synced with Salesforce.
Operations Hub
Critical client and case data flows automatically into Airtable databases , leveraging the clients standing architecture and powering service teams, creating a transparent handoff.
Leadership Dashboards
Real‑time team performance and financial reporting provide actionable insights for decision‑makers.
